@@ -618,11 +618,13 @@ internal windows only. */)
DEFUN ("set-window-combination-limit", Fset_window_combination_limit, Sset_window_combination_limit, 2, 2, 0,
doc: /* Set combination limit of window WINDOW to LIMIT; return LIMIT.
-WINDOW must be a valid window and defaults to the selected one.
If LIMIT is nil, child windows of WINDOW can be recombined with WINDOW's
siblings. LIMIT t means that child windows of WINDOW are never
\(re-)combined with WINDOW's siblings. Other values are reserved for
-future use. */)
+future use.
+
+WINDOW must be a valid window. Setting the combination limit is
+meaningful for internal windows only. */)
(Lisp_Object window, Lisp_Object limit)
